About this role
At Venteur, we're transforming healthcare by empowering individuals to control how trillions of dollars are spent on their behalf. As a Senior Software Engineer, you will drive the delivery of our platform, directly impacting thousands of people managing their health insurance needs.
You will collaborate with cross-functional teams to define technical and business requirements, design end-to-end experiences, and architect scalable systems. Your day-to-day involves working closely with designers, engineers, operations, and customers to deliver solutions that exceed expectations.
You'll work in-person at our office near San Francisco's Financial District, collaborating directly with the CEO and members of Engineering, Product, Finance, Growth, and Customer teams. Our culture emphasizes kindness, bias for action, and insisting on the highest standards.
As an early employee of a future giant in technology, you'll have immense opportunities for career growth and advancement, along with the financial benefits of joining a Series A startup. Join us in paving the way toward a healthier, more personalized future.
